Food Distribution Program on Indian Reservations (10.567)

To improve the diets of needy persons in households on or near Indian reservations through the distribution of commodities.

Grants for Dental Public Health Residency Training (93.236)

To plan and develop new residency training programs and to maintain or improve existing residency training programs in dental public health; and to provide financial assistance to residency trainees enrolled in such programs.

 

Grants for Preventive Medicine (93.117)

To promote the post-graduate education of physicians in preventive medicine.

Grants to States for Operation of Offices of Rural Health (93.913)

To improve health care in rural areas through the establishment of State Offices of Rural Health.
